Welcome to Iboats Lauren,

I must admit I'm a little bit confused about your post. Did you want more info about your boat or the engines in general? For the engines, look on either side of them for a plate that has Volvo Penta on it (should look like this View attachment 128813) . It will have a model number and serial number. If the engines are original, they would most likely be coupled to 200 series drives (most likely a 270 or 280).

If you can, take pictures, and post them to this site. Most of us good eye, and can give you some idea's about what you have.
